New York Life Insurance's investment division has secured a $75 million loan against Evanston's Park Evanston apartment complex located at 1630 Chicago Avenue. The multifamily property consists of 283 units and is situated in the robust Evanston market. The loan, provided by PGIM Real Estate, will be used to refinance the property's existing debt, reducing it from the previous $88 million loan obtained in 2018. This reflects a trend among Chicago-area landlords injecting funds into existing loans to secure new financing amid recent interest rate hikes, highlighting the strong demand in the Evanston multifamily market.
